Blank Pages

He who was seated on the throne said, “Look! I am making all things new.” Then He said to me, “Write, for these words are faithful and true.”

Revelation 21:5 MEV


We all have our chances to start anew. As we choose to close the book of yesterday and begin to open a new chapter, God will surely fill those blank pages with stories that will overshadow the past. I love to write journals and devotionals. And every time I have a new Notebook to write on, I get so excited thinking that I can begin with a clean slate and put the old one on the shelf. The same way goes whenever we have to reset the months and weeks back to one. It’s as if we’re given another journal so that we can write a different story from last year. Every time we get to celebrate New Year’s Eve, we are in that moment where we get to decide whether we’ll leave the old to embrace the future or remain stuck–clinging to what’s behind.

It’s exciting to witness new things come to life, new memories to create and new hope to arise. I believe God is the God who loves to make all things New. He doesn’t dwell on the past nor get limited by it. He’s fond of doing new stories and miracles in each of our lives. He doesn’t want to rewrite the same thing all over again. That’s why God puts all of them on the history list so that He can surprise us with what He has in store. He’s not the God of the relics but He’s the God of New Beginnings.

For this same reason, Christ told us in Revelations 21:5 to watch Him make all things new. He wants us to expect for something we have not seen or experienced before. He wants us to write down what He’s about to do and testify His goodness. I write so that I can share God’s faithfulness and so that people will know that there is a Father in heaven that loves and cares for us.


We may always find it hard to let go of what was behind but as soon as we take courage to do so, expect God to make new things in your life. He can turn your sorrows to joy, your mourning to dancing, your ashes to beauty–giving you another reason to be grateful about life. It doesn’t matter how your 2017 was. God can give you a much better year this 2018. Believe for new miracles, for answered prayers, for grace and love to chase after you. Believe that God is with you in every battle you are to face this year. He will never leave you and He will make sure that you finish strong this 2018–accomplishing what you are meant to do. You are blessed and highly favored. This is your chance to start over again. Don’t let pain, regrets nor fear hold you back. Be brave and face this brand new year believing that God is making all things new.
